1:28Now PlayingThe government of Saint Lucia, led by Prime Minister Hon. Philip J. Pierre, will NOT TAX any government contract with a value not exceeding $10, 000.
Before Prime Minister Pierre took Office, all government contracts were subject to a 10% income tax deduction. Prime Minister Pierre has intervened. New legislation has passed to increase profitability and keep more money in the pockets of small contractors.
The government will no longer deduct income tax from government contracts valued at $10,000 or less.
